This is my most useful wind site - from Two Brothers rocks in Pillsbury Sound so very accurate local info for the STT-STJ sailing.

https://ww.sailflow.com/windandwhere.iws?regionID=260&siteID=3876

Combined with the swell report from this buoy should give good planning

https://www.ndbc.noaa.gov/show_plot...uom=E&time_diff=0&time_label=GMT

Originally Posted by Winterstale
We are pretty psyched!! What wind app do you use?? I have been using Windy but is there one that’s better??


“Sailflow pro” gives actual live wind data from scattered anemometers. Off the top of my head, there is one on Buck island amongst several others. The live data arrows are a different color then the forecasted ones.
